The Stripping-Ultrasonic-Electrolysis (SUE) method is a new decontamination method. Based on mixing solid super-acid in original stripping and taking out ultrasonic, the dry electrolysis decontamination method(DEDM) for radioactive contamination on metal was studied.The SO42- /TiO2 solid super-acid whose acid strength was to be -13.20 0<-11.99 was prepared. Used PYA/PVAc as main ingredient, poly-aniline which adulterated with HC1 and SO42-/TiO2 solid super-acid as electric component, the electric stripping was prepared. Result in experiment indicated that electro-conductibility was 20.5S/m and the mechanical property can be satisfactory to application when the contents of poly-aniline and SO425-/TiO2 solid super-acid were 5% and 1.5% respectively.Infrared spectroscopy analysis showed that the conductive structure of poly-aniline which adulterated with HC1 and SO42-/TiO2 solid super-acid didn't change when they were mixed into stripping.The result in simulative experiment show: the decontamination efficiency (DF) of directness coating method on the surface of metal was from 99% to 87% with processing temperature increasing; the DF of SUE was more than 98%;The D F o f D EDM w as a ccording w ith S UE w hen e lectrolytic v oltage was 2.1 V, drying time of stripping was 8h and electrolytic time were 2530 min.The result in practical experiment show: the DF of DEDM for stainless steel was more than 96% when origin contaminated level was less than 8Bq/cm2, the contaminated level after contamination was about 0.2Bq/cm2; the D F o f D EDM for alnico w as m ore t nan 9 6% w hen t he r ange o f o rigin contaminated level were 10 Bq/cm2 to 16Bq/cm2, the contaminated level after contamination was about 0.4Bq/cm2; the DF of DEDM for corrosion carbon steel was more than 93% when the range of origin contaminated level were 20 Bq/cm2 to 70Bq/cm2, the contaminated level after contamination was max 4.87Bq/cm2.Because of excellent decontamination efficiency, less secondary waster, and simple handle, the dry electrolysis decontamination method can be applied to decontamination in the decommissioning project of nuclear facility.
